Crush Oreo cookies.
Mix crumbs with enough melted butter to press into the bottom of a round spring-form pan (a regular pan can be used).
Place in the freezer until firm.
Remove from freeze and fill pan with coffee ice cream, pressing down firmly. Place in freezer again until ice cream is firm.
(This dessert may be made in layers.) Cover with fudge topping (using a warm topping is easier to spread).
Place in freezer to set.
When fudge is hard, cover with whipped topping and serve.
Use a container with a top.
Crunch Oreo cookies in the bottom of container.
Spread enough melted butter to cover the cookies. Spread thawed ice cream over cookie crumbs.
Put hot fudge in microwave until melted, then cover the ice cream.
Crunch more Oreo cookies over the fudge and cover with Cool Whip.
Cover the ice cream cake with lid and put in freezer.
Leave in freezer 2 to 3 hours, then serve!
Line 9 inch round cake pan with plastic wrap.
Arrange cookies in bottom of pan.
Spread ice cream over cookies.
Reserve 1/2 cup fudge sauce. Drizzle/pour remaining fudge over ice cream.
Mix candy into whipped topping. Spread over fudge sauce.
Drizzle remaining fudge sauce onto topping.
Freeze 4 hours or overnight.
Lift cake out of pan; peel off plastic wrap.
Let stand 10 minutes.
Top with additional candy, if desired.
Put Oreos in a plastic bag and crush into crumbs with a rolling pin.
Spread half the Oreo crumbs in a 13 x 9-inch cake pan.
Spread softened ice cream over Oreo crumbs.
Top with remaining Oreo crumbs.
Chill until set.
Before freezing, you can drizzle with chocolate syrup.
When serving, you can offer choices of hot fudge, whipped cream, cherries, nuts - the gooier the better!
